From: First insights into the movements and vertical habitat use of blue marlin (Makaira nigricans) in the eastern North Atlantic

Fig. 1

Estimated most probable tracks for three blue marlin, BM1 (A), BM2 (B) and BM3 (C), equipped with pop-up satellite archival tags off Madeira, Portugal in August 2012. Circles are daily estimates of location derived from transmitted light, depth and temperature data and are coloured by month and deployment and pop-up locations. Inset map indicates location of study region. Polygons represent the merged probability density surfaces for each PSAT, with light to dark shades representing 95%, 75% and 50% probability contours. Note that the horizontal scale differs between maps
